Vikings hold off Franklin Parish
by Joey Martin - posted E-mail Story E-mail Story | Print Story Print Story 
Vidalia High's final non-district scheduled home game proved to be a good test for the Vikings, who improved to 18-1 with a hard-fought 82-74 win over Franklin Parish Tuesday.

The Vikings finish their non-district schedule Friday at Tioga before the Lady Vikings host Marksville Tuesday.

Vidalia High boys coach Robert Sanders is actually trying to find an opponent for the boys team after the girls play Marksville on Tuesday.

In Class 3A, the girls begin playoffs earlier than the boys and finish up their district schedule earlier.

Vidalia jumped ahead of Franklin Parish 23-16 in the first period before the Patriots cut that lead to 39-36 at halftime.

Vidalia outscored Franklin Parish 18-10 in the third period.

Quartrell Thomas led Vidalia with 28 points, while Gary Stewart added 19 and Torrey Dixon 11.

In the girls contest, Franklin Parish led 18-9 after one period before the Lady Vikings cut that lead to 27-20 at halftime.

Both teams scored 15 points in the third period and the Lady Vikings kept it close throughout the final quarter.

Gabrielle Wagoner led Vidalia with 15 points, while Tyshica Rodgers added 12 and Erika Brown 10.
